Introverts and Unemployment - Notes from the Trenches, Part 2

"Introverts are best suited for jobs in which they don't have to work on teams all the time," says Shoya Zichy, author (with Ann Bidou) of Career Match: Connecting You You Are with What You'll Love to Do. She shares that introverts do best when they can spend a large part of the day working in a fairly private space. She continues, "Introverts get energized from their inner resources - that is, from spending time alone to recharge their inner batteries. Even if they like being with people, which most introverts do, interacting too much can drain their energy." Adds an advertising account executive we'll call Sharon Ryan,  "As an introvert, I need alone time to think deeply and decompress. I use that time to consider my options and to reflect on what's important to me - and where I want to grow." Read More

Introvert or extrovert?

Hi Jean,

A quick and simple guideline is to look at what you're drawn to more than 50% of the time – quiet activities that you do alone (introvert) or social activities (extrovert). Also, consider what you do on weekends. Do you prefer spending more time engaged in activities like reading and gardening (introvert) or getting together with groups of friends and going to parties (extrovert)? Of course, many introverts enjoy socializing. However, unlike extroverts, introverts recharge their energy during their quiet time. You can take the MBTI® tool or another personality assessment to discover more about your personality type.
